What was grant's plan for ending the war?

Social Studies
1 answer:
charle [14.2K]3 years ago
3 0
Is plan was to fight the confedracy and to win that battle
<span>He believed that he could win only by waging total war - destroying all food, homes, farms, buildings etc .. Basically any supplies that the Confederate could use</span>

Pre socraticos y su aporte para la historia de la ciencia
jenyasd209 [6]

Answer:

Attention to questions about the origin and nature of the physical world

Explanation:

Pre-Socratics, group of early Greek philosophers, most of whom were born before Socrates, whose attention to questions about the origin and nature of the physical world has led to their being called cosmologists or naturalists. Among the most significant were the Milesians Thales, Anaximander, and Anaximenes, Xenophanes of Colophon, Parmenides, Heracleitus of Ephesus, Empedocles, Anaxagoras, Democritus, Zeno of Elea, and Pythagoras.
